Fingal County Council in exercise of the powers conferred on it under Section 38 of the Road Traffic Act, 1994 and Section 46 of the Public Transport Regulation Act, 2009 hereby gives notice that it has prepared a Scheme for the provision of traffic calming measures at the following locations:
Seatown Road, Swords – In the interests of road safety and convenience for all road users, Fingal County Council is proposing to introduce traffic calming measures on Seatown Road, Swords. The scheme provides for raised tables, ramps, line marking, uncontrolled crossings, bollards and associated engineering works.
St. Columcille’s Drive, Swords - In the interests of road safety and convenience for all road users, Fingal County Council is proposing to introduce traffic calming measures on St. Columcille’s Drive, Swords. The scheme provides for raised tables, ramps, line marking, uncontrolled crossings and associated engineering works.

All comments, including the names of those making comments, submitted to the Council in regard to this Traffic Calming Scheme will form part of the statutory report to be presented to the monthly meeting of Fingal County Council.
Accordingly the statutory report will list the persons or bodies who made submissions or observations with respect to the proposed Traffic Calming Scheme in accordance with the regulations of the Road Traffic Act 1994.
The submissions will also be included in the minutes of that meeting and consequently will appear on the Council’s Website. By making a submission the name of individual or bodies will appear on the statutory report and minutes of the meeting.
